About Plevna School

Plevna School is a public elementary school in Plevna, MT, part of Plevna K-12 Schools. Plevna School serves approximately 73 students, and covers grades Pre-K-6th, and has a 9.1:1 student-teacher ratio. Plevna School has a current MySchoolScout rating of 5.6 out of 10 and ranks #393 of 603 schools in MT.

Structured state assessment records for Plevna School show 57% math proficiency (multi-year average, 2009-2022) and 64% reading/ELA proficiency (multi-year average, 2009-2022).

What Parents Should Know

At 73 students, Plevna School is on the smaller side. That usually buys more individual attention and teachers who know every kid by name, with the trade-off of fewer electives and extracurriculars than a larger school can staff. Ask what activities it actually offers.

At 9.1:1 students to teachers, Plevna School sits well below the national average. Smaller classes like that usually mean more one-on-one time between students and teachers.

Plevna School sits in a rural area, which can mean longer drives for some families. Rural schools are often community anchors with smaller classes, but check transportation, after-school options, and access to specialized services before you commit.
